(The Borough of The Bronx). - History of the Bronx, Borough of Progress.

Title: History of the Bronx, Borough of Progress.
Description: The Bronx, NY: The Borough of the Bronx, circa [1965]. [1965]. - Quarto [approximately 11 inches high by 8-1/2 inches wide], softcover with the contents stapled to a printed green cover sheet. The top corners of the cover sheet are lightly creased & there are 2 pinholes where a 2nd staple has been removed. [i], 12 & [4] mechanically reproduced pages printed on one side only. The top right corners of the pages are creased. There is creasing & a tear to the left edge of the last page. Good. "The year, 1964, had a very special meaning for the County of The Bronx. It was a year that celebrated its birthday with a year-long Golden Jubilee [1914-1964] to expose its residents and to the nation at large the many facets of living, working and playing in The Bronx and the progress made in the last five decades." This first paragraph of the text is preceded by the lyrics of the official song of the jubilee by Herb Miller. The text was compiled with the assistance of an unnamed civic organization and was issued by the Office of the President of the Borough of The Bronx, the Honorable Joseph F. Periconi [the Honorable Vincent A. Starace, Deputy President]. Rare. Good .
